Mimosatek

IoT Platforms

Provider of data, decision support and remote control capabilities for agricultural requirements. The company offers a sensor and cloud technology based platform which help farmers to monitor environmental factors, drought alerts, soil humidity and plants database for agricultural requirements.

Edgeworx

IoT Platforms

Developer of a computing application platform intended to provide a standardized way to develop and remotely deploy secure micro services to edge computing devices. The company's platform standardizes running software at the edge by enabling microservices to run quickly, easily and reliably, making the deployment process simple by abstracting the underlying hardware to provide a common compute platform that enables the same software to run on any device, allowing developers to package and deploy their applications to each device using containerization technologies such as Docker and Unikernels.

SicommNet

IoT Platforms

Secure Internet Commerce Network Inc. (SicommNet) was founded in 1998 by a team including public sector procurement management; supply chain professionals and information technology trailblazers who developed and implemented online eProcurement systems for electronically automating and managing government agency buying and selling processes. SicommNet became the first United States based company to successfully provide public sector eProcurement application “Software as a Service” (SaaS) to State and local government municipalities and their respective vendor customers. Today this is referred to as “Running in the Cloud” secure hosted service. SicommNet offers an enterprise eProcurement software suite. Our eProcurement suite offers end-to-end eProcurement processes including requisition and solicitation creations, approvals, opportunity postings and notifications to registered vendors, vendor pre-bid conference announcements and pre-registration, addendum notifications, vendor question and answer periods, vendor electronic submission of response, sealed bid opening, bid tabulation and internal distribution evaluations, and electronic notifications of awards, followed by purchase orders, shipping notification, receipt, (and when integrated with the Agency Financial Accounting System) authorization for payment. Our additional eProcurement capabilities include eCatalog, contract tracking, ad hoc reporting, and spend analysis.
